Postby The Dark Knight » Fri Oct 18, 2019 9:12 pm

Stumps day one
Queensland v SA
SA 221
QLD 3/70

Not a bad position for SA to be in now with Queensland still trailing by 151.

WA v Victoria
Victoria 6/277
Harris 69
Pucovski 64
Richardson 3/45

NSW v Tasmania
Tas 6/258
Webster 65
Starc 2/36
